VMware vSphere:掌握VMvisor SSH登录技巧

vmware-vmvisor ssh登录

时间:2025-01-13 06:11


深入探索:VMware ESXi(vmvisor)的SSH登录与安全实践 在虚拟化技术的广阔天地中,VMware ESXi(也称为vmvisor)凭借其强大的功能、高效的性能以及广泛的兼容性,成为了众多企业和数据中心不可或缺的基础设施组件

    作为VMware虚拟化套件的核心,ESXi不仅简化了虚拟机的管理,还通过其内置的诸多工具和特性,为IT运维人员提供了前所未有的灵活性和控制力

    其中,SSH(Secure Shell)登录功能便是这样一项强大而实用的特性,它允许运维人员通过命令行界面直接访问和管理ESXi主机,执行一系列高级操作

    本文将深入探讨VMware ESXi的SSH登录机制、安全实践以及在日常运维中的应用

     一、VMware ESXi与SSH登录简介 VMware ESXi是一种专为运行虚拟机而设计的轻量级操作系统,它去除了传统操作系统中不必要的组件,专注于提供虚拟化服务

    这种设计不仅提高了系统的稳定性和安全性,还降低了资源消耗

    SSH作为一种加密的网络协议,用于在不安全的网络中安全地传输数据,为远程管理提供了强有力的保障

     在ESXi环境中,启用SSH登录意味着管理员可以通过SSH客户端(如PuTTY、SecureCRT等)从远程终端连接到ESXi主机,执行诸如查看系统日志、修改配置文件、安装补丁、重启服务等操作

    这一功能对于快速排查问题、执行紧急维护以及自动化脚本部署尤为重要

     二、启用SSH登录的步骤 虽然SSH登录功能强大,但出于安全考虑,默认情况下ESXi的SSH服务是关闭的

    要启用SSH,你需要按照以下步骤操作: 1.通过vSphere Client或Host Client访问ESXi主机:首先,你需要通过vSphere Client(基于Web的vSphere Host Client)登录到你的ESXi主机

     2.导航至“配置”选项卡:在vSphere Host Client中,选择左侧的“配置”选项卡,然后找到“服务”部分

     3.启用SSH服务:在服务列表中,找到“TSM-SSH”服务(对于某些版本的ESXi,可能是“SSH”服务),将其启动类型设置为“手动”或“自动”,并点击“启动”按钮

     4.验证SSH端口:默认情况下,ESXi的SSH服务监听在TCP端口22上

    确保你的防火墙规则允许从管理网络到该端口的流量

     5.配置防火墙规则(如需要):如果ESXi主机部署在严格受限的网络环境中,你可能需要手动配置防火墙规则以允许SSH流量

     三、SSH登录的安全实践 尽管SSH登录为ESXi管理带来了极大便利,但其安全性也不容忽视

    以下是一些关键的安全实践建议: 1.限制访问来源:通过防火墙规则严格限制能够访问SSH服务的IP地址范围,最好是仅限于受信任的管理网络和特定的管理设备

     2.使用强密码策略:确保所有具有SSH访问权限的账户都遵循强密码策略,包括定期更换密码、使用复杂字符组合等

     3.禁用root登录:为了增强安全性,应禁用root账户的SSH登录,而是使用具有适当权限的非root账户进行操作

    通过vSphere Client创建新用户,并分配必要的角色和权限

     4.启用SSH密钥认证:相比密码认证,基于密钥的认证方式更为安全

    你可以生成SSH密钥对(公钥和私钥),将公钥上传到ESXi主机,并使用私钥进行登录

     5.监控与日志审计:启用并定期检查SSH登录日志,监控任何异常登录尝试

    使用ESXi的syslog功能或第三方日志管理工具来收集和分析日志数据

     6.定期更新与补丁管理:保持ESXi主机及其上运行的所有软件(包括VMware Tools)的最新状态,及时应用安全补丁,以防范已知漏洞

     四、SSH登录在运维中的应用案例 SSH登录在ESXi运维中的应用场景广泛,以下是一些典型案例: - 紧急故障排查:当ESXi主机遇到严重问题(如无法通过网络界面访问)时,SSH登录提供了一种直接访问系统的方法,允许管理员快速定位问题原因并采取措施

     - 自动化脚本部署:利用SSH,运维人员可以编写自动化脚本,用于批量配置ESXi主机、部署虚拟机模板或执行定期维护任务,显著提高运维效率

     - 性能调优与监控:通过SSH命令行,可以运行诸如`esxtop`、`vmstat`等工具,实时监控ESXi主机的性能指标,为性能调优提供依据

     - 软件升级与补丁安装:虽然vSphere Update Manager提供了更便捷的升级途径,但在某些情况下,通过SSH手动安装补丁或升级软件包也是必要的

     五、结语 总而言之,VMware ESXi的SSH登录功能是一把双刃剑,既为运维人员提供了强大的远程管理手段,也带来了潜在的安全风险

    因此,在享受SSH带来的便利的同时,必须严格遵守安全实践,确保ESXi主机的安全稳定运行

    通过合理配置防火墙规则、实施强密码策略、启用密钥认证、定期审计日志以及保持系统更新,可以有效提升SSH登录的安全性,为虚拟化环境的健康发展保驾护航